Languages TedX: A series of short presentations on languages and policy

July 16, 2021 By nikitajoshi Leave a Comment

On 15 July 2021, Pascale Vassie, Director, National Resource Centre for Supplementary Education (NRCSE) presented CLEx at the APPG on Modern Language TedX: A series of short presentations on languages and policy.

The new Community Language Examination Centre (CLEx) is enabling more students to achieve a qualification in their home or heritage language.

Entering-language-GCSEs-via-CLEx-APPG-presentation

Agenda:
1.     An update on legislation and languages: Baroness Coussins, Co-Chair of the APPG on Modern Languages
2.     An update from GCHQ on cross-government language activity: GCHQ
3.     The new Civil Service Languages Network: Hugo Griffin and Matthew Brown, founders
4.     The 2021 Language Trends survey of primary and secondary schools in England: Ian Collen, Queen’s University Belfast, lead author of the report
5.     Established in February 2021, the new Community Language Examination Centre (CLEx) is enabling more students to achieve a qualification in their home or heritage language: Pascale Vassie, Director, NRCSE

Please read the guide to revalidation on this page. When you are sure all documents are up to date contact the National Resource Centre Quality Development Team, or your local authority mentor to submit your management file for scrutiny, and book a recognition meeting.

The registration/revalidation fee for a quality assurance recognition meeting to achieve the NRCSE Quality Mark is £130. To book and pay for your revalidation go to the online shop
